Child’s dress from the legacy of the Trachtenherc family, March ’68 emigrants.

This is one of several keepsakes from the childhood of Anna Trachtenherc (1946–2022), daughter of Natan (1910–1991) and Maria (1913–2006), which the family took with them when emigrating to Sweden due to the intensifying antisemitic atmosphere in Poland.

The dress is made of cotton fabric in two colors. The lower part is sewn from light blue fabric. The bodice, sleeves, and collar are made of fabric printed with colorful flowers. The sleeves (puffed) and the collar are trimmed with decorative binding made of the same light blue material. The collar is tied with a thin string in the same color. Near the bottom edge of the dress (approximately one-third of the way up), there is a decorative floral fabric trim sewn on in a wavy pattern.
